    Asphalt Millings

    Where do you live? I know here in Florida it's cheap ($100 triaxle) in NY it's like $700. I live on a millings road (county) and have a millings driveway, except near the house / shop (concrete). I love it. Compact it best you can initially, rain, heat, traffic = asphalt.

    40x60x16

    Applying for permit today. 40x60x16 Pole barn construction 2 - 14x14 roll ups on southern gable end 2 - 36" doors, one on SW long wall, one on NE gable end 8 - windows, 4 centered every 12' on W long wall, 4 centered on E long wall, NE "bay" no window 18" overhang w/ soffit wainscot insulation

    Tankless water heater

    I have a Rinnai at my home, and several different brands at my business'. Here is what I tell everyone; Forget about ROI. I don't know if I am saving money or not. I do know this, I have never, ever ran out of hot water. 3 shower's at a time, no problem. The big thing to pay attention to...
